As the Senior Policy and Programmes Officer you will:

  • Provide policy and project support to Mental Health Network (MHN) member forums and wider team and be supported to develop your knowledge of mental health and learning disability policy;
  • Help support the effective running of member forums and produce outputs to highlight and influence key issues for MHN members, while showcasing good practice;
  • Develop and maintain positive working relationships internally and with relevant partner organisations to ensure we understand issues that will impact on MHN members;
  • Support the scoping, discussion and production of policy briefs, consultation responses and other products to agreed timetables and deadlines;
  • Support the effective running of high-level meetings and events.

About you

We would love to hear from you if you:

  • Have an understanding of the current health and care landscape;
  • Have a passion for improving mental health services, and an appetite and interest in building knowledge of policy areas within mental health and learning disabilities services;
  • Can plan projects or work programmes and have proven experience of delivering work to agreed standards and deadlines;
  • Hold experience of supporting high-level meetings;
  • Can work with people with lived experience of mental health problems with compassion and understanding.
